You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@camel.apache.org by as...@apache.org on 2019/12/18 12:34:48 UTC

[camel-k] 03/13: fix(build): Fix platform Spec to Status migration leftovers

This is an automated email from the ASF dual-hosted git repository.

astefanutti pushed a commit to branch master
in repository https://gitbox.apache.org/repos/asf/camel-k.git

commit 9e174ba13956cc693cc435ef7a5f4082b01c8be9
Author: Antonin Stefanutti <an...@stefanutti.fr>
AuthorDate: Mon Dec 16 14:07:29 2019 +0100

    fix(build): Fix platform Spec to Status migration leftovers
---
 pkg/controller/build/build_controller.go | 2 +-
 pkg/trait/builder.go                     | 2 +-
 2 files changed, 2 insertions(+), 2 deletions(-)

diff --git a/pkg/controller/build/build_controller.go b/pkg/controller/build/build_controller.go
index f9ef70c..6e9897f 100644
--- a/pkg/controller/build/build_controller.go
+++ b/pkg/controller/build/build_controller.go
@@ -176,7 +176,7 @@ func (r *ReconcileBuild) Reconcile(request reconcile.Request) (reconcile.Result,
 
 	var actions []Action
 
-	switch pl.Spec.Build.BuildStrategy {
+	switch pl.Status.Build.BuildStrategy {
 	case v1alpha1.IntegrationPlatformBuildStrategyPod:
 		actions = []Action{
 			NewInitializePodAction(),
diff --git a/pkg/trait/builder.go b/pkg/trait/builder.go
index b65fd8c..a81f841 100644
--- a/pkg/trait/builder.go
+++ b/pkg/trait/builder.go
@@ -118,7 +118,7 @@ func (t *builderTrait) Apply(e *Environment) error {
 				Name: "camel-k-builder",
 				VolumeSource: corev1.VolumeSource{
 					PersistentVolumeClaim: &corev1.PersistentVolumeClaimVolumeSource{
-						ClaimName: e.Platform.Spec.Build.PersistentVolumeClaim,
+						ClaimName: e.Platform.Status.Build.PersistentVolumeClaim,
 					},
 				},
 			})